Express Entry: IRCC Invites 1,325 Candidates in the Latest All-Program Draw
Immigration, Refugees, and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) conducted its fourth Express Entry draw of the month, inviting 1,325 candidates across all programs. The draw, held on December 18, 2023, marked a crucial event for aspiring immigrants, with a Comprehensive Ranking System (CRS) cutoff score of 542.
The draw follows a series of targeted draws earlier in December, including a focus on STEM occupations, French proficiency, and a general all-program draw.
Express Entry Draw Highlights: 18 December, 2023
- Draw Date and Time: December 18, 2023, at 16:12:22 UTC.
- Number of Invitations Issued: 1,325
- CRS Score of Lowest-Ranked Candidate: 542
- Tie-Breaking Rule: Before November 06, 2023, at 14:40:23 UTC
Express Entry candidates now have a 60-day window to submit their applications, with processing expected within the standard six-month timeframe.
A Recap of Recent Draws in December
After an unexpected pause in Express Entry draws lasting for five weeks, IRCC made a triumphant return with three consecutive draws from December 6th to 8th.
- The December 8 draw focused on STEM occupations, extending 5,900 invitations to candidates with a minimum CRS of 481.
- On December 7, a category-based draw targeted individuals with French language proficiency, resulting in 1,000 invitations with a minimum CRS of 470.
- December 6 marked an all-program draw after over a month, inviting candidates with a minimum CRS of 561.
- The last draw before the December series, on October 26, was a category-based selection for healthcare occupations.
The recent draw on December 18th adds to a total of 12,975 Invitations to Apply (ITAs) issued since the resumption. The cumulative data showcases the diversity of draws, catering to various candidate profiles and occupational backgrounds.

What Sets the Express Entry Apart?
Express Entry, Canada’s premier application management system, oversees three significant economic immigration programs: the Federal Skilled Worker Program (FSWP), the Canadian Experience Class (CEC), and the Federal Skilled Trades Program (FSTP).
Employing the Comprehensive Ranking System, Express Entry evaluates candidates based on human capital factors such as work experience, language proficiency, education, age, and occupation. The highest CRS scorers receive coveted Invitations to Apply, paving the way for permanent residence in Canada.
